A forward-thinking benefits platform in Greater London is seeking a Product Manager to drive product discovery and strategy. You will own the entire product area, ensuring customer voices guide development.
We are looking for strategic thinkers who thrive in fast-paced environments and enjoy solving complex problems.
This role offers a competitive salary and extensive benefits, including a work-from-anywhere scheme and enhanced parental leave.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ben
✨Know the Product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the benefits platform and its features. Familiarise yourself with the product's strengths and weaknesses, and think about how you would enhance it. This will show that you're genuinely interested and ready to take ownership.
✨Showcase Your Strategic Thinking
Prepare examples of how you've successfully driven product discovery and strategy in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ses. This will help demonstrate your ability to think strategically and solve complex problems effectively.
✨Emphasise Customer-Centric Development
Since the role involves ensuring customer voices guide development, be ready to discuss how you've gathered and implemented customer feedback in previous roles. Share specific instances where customer insights led to successful product changes or innovations.
✨Be Ready for Fast-Paced Scenarios
Given the fast-paced environment, prepare to discuss how you handle pressure and adapt to changing priorities. Think of examples where you've thrived under tight deadlines or managed multiple projects simultaneously, showcasing your agility and resilience.
